My first time going to Hiatus, and there were positives and a few misses. The first big miss was scheduling, they scheduled the wrong service. I requested the Glow Getter, mani and pedi. They scheduled The Body Glow instead of the Glow Getter. Apparently they are supposed to send email confirmation when services are booked (I booked over the phone), but I never received one. The front desk staff were nice, as in they weren't rude, however they are also lacking in customer service skills. If you schedule something wrong, you should at least say 'I'm sorry' for the mistake, but no apologies given. They seemed clueless as to how to handle it beyond we're booked, so we can't do the service you wanted today. The difference between the service I requested and what they booked is a massage, which I wanted but didn't get with the Body Glow. I decided to go ahead and go with what was booked, since it still involved the vichy shower. I will say The Body Glow was a wonderful service, Kara did a great job and was both very thorough and very thoughtful. I would highly recommend Kara. The mani & pedi service itself is very relaxing, however the polish they use (SpaRituals I believe) is disappointing. It chips rather quickly. I had a chip on a fingernail within a day and on my toes within 3 days. I know we can be tough on our fingernails, but there is no excuse for a pedicure lasting only 3 days. As much as I enjoyed the service itself, I couldn't see paying for it again knowing their polish won't last at all. The spa facilities were nice, but not amazing. I will go again to Hiatus, only because I still have an additional gift card to use. After I use up the gift card, undecided. We'll see how the next trip goes.
